Bucs Lose To Colts; Todd Bowles’ Seat Is Broiling

 

The Buccaneers struggled in most phases of today’s 27-20 loss to Indianapolis. At least Kyle Trask threw a nice incomplete pass.

Did Todd Bowles’ team look physical, hungry and on point? Absolutely not. And what are the excuses for that? There are none.

After today’s humbling and somewhat embarrassing lost to a barely average Colts team in Indianapolis, Bowles’ Bucs are now 4-7 and losers of six of their last seven games. In simple terms, they stink.

The defense looked sluggish and the backups didn’t deliver what was needed. Heck, Vita Vea didn’t get on the stat sheet and Devin White reminds Joe of Mason Foster with bad back. Nearly everything looks difficult for the Tampa Bay offense. The special teams aren’t special. And Bowles continues to say the team is close.

It can’t continue.

Bucs coaches have been fired for less and Bowles is crusing at 80 miles per hour toward that fate unless the Bucs can deliver a heroic turnaround to this season. From 3-1 to 4-7, damn.

As usual, Team Glazer was in attendance today. Joe watched Ed Glazer and Joel Glazer conference on the field before the game, and Joe also saw Joel Glazer in deep discussion with Jason Licht. Bryan Glazer had an animated pregame chat with Licht, too.

Perhaps that was all about stock picks and whatever super rich guys talk about, but it might have been about setting up an emergency Monday meeting if the Bucs continued down the dark path Bowles has led them.
